A professional MUA is so much more than the person responsible for how you look on your wedding day or special event. We’re often the very first point of contact in your day. The first person to sit with you, feel your energy, calm your nerves, and help set the tone before everything begins.
There’s something unique and intimate about being this type of artist. We’re close enough to witness the raw, unfiltered moments, yet just outside your inner circle in a way that often makes it easier to exhale and be your most unfiltered-self. That balance creates a kind of comfort that’s hard to explain until you experience it especially on days that can feel emotional, overwhelming, and deeply personal all at once.
Choosing the right MUA isn’t only about finding someone whose work you love. It’s about choosing someone whose presence makes you feel grounded, understood, and like the most authentic version of yourself. Because the way you feel that day will ✨ always ✨ matter just as much as (if not more than) the way you look!
